All DBPR Inspector Observations

19 full violation description(s) documented by the inspector during this visit.

High Priority 3

#10High Priority03A-02-5

High Priority – Time/temperature control for safety food cold held at greater than 41 degrees Fahrenheit. On top of prep cooler – fresh garlic in oil (83F – Cold Holding at 3:30), per staff item was prepared at 11am, staff discarded. Staff was advised to keep item cold held at 41F or below or on time as a public health control

#11High Priority03F-02-5

High Priority – Time/temperature control for safety food identified in the written procedure as a food held using time as a public health control has no time marking and the time removed from temperature control cannot be determined. All pizza slices at front counter with no time mark, staff voluntarily discarded all slices during inspection. Per staff, pizza slices only offered from 11-3pm.

#12High Priority03B-01-6

High Priority – Time/temperature control for safety food, other than whole meat roast, hot held at less than 135 degrees Fahrenheit. Above stove – grilled chicken (119F – Hot Holding), per staff item held during lunch hours, staff voluntarily discarded
